#bd30d9 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#bd30d9 is composed of 74.1% red, 18.8%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.9% cyan, 77.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 290.1 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 52%. #bd30d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ff60ff with #7b00b3.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

● #bd30d9 color description : Bright magenta.
The hexadecimal color #bd30d9 has RGB values of R:189, G:48,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 12398809.
